Sports-injury-related Conditions Treated at Momentum

Sprains and Strains

Overstretching or tearing of ligaments (sprains) and muscles or tendons (strains) are frequent injuries in athletes, which we treat effectively with therapeutic exercises, pain management strategies, and education on prevention.

Fractures

We provide post-fracture care, helping patients regain function and strength through targeted exercises and strategies for a safe return to sports.

Overuse Injuries

Conditions like tennis elbow, golfer’s elbow, runner’s knee, shin splints, and stress fractures, often caused by repetitive strain on specific body parts, are managed using a combination of rest, therapeutic exercises, and preventive education.

Tendonitis and Tendinopathy

Inflammation or degeneration of tendons, often seen in the Achilles, patella, and rotator cuff tendons in athletes, can be effectively treated with physiotherapy.

Post-Surgical Rehabilitation

We work with athletes who have undergone surgeries such as ACL reconstruction, meniscus repair, rotator cuff repair, and more, helping them return to their sport safely and efficiently.

Joint Dislocations

Following medical management of a dislocated joint, physiotherapy helps restore function and strength, while reducing the risk of future dislocations.

Concussions

We offer concussion management programs, helping athletes recover and return to their sport safely.

Muscle Imbalances

We help athletes correct muscle imbalances that can affect performance and lead to injuries.

Chronic Pain Conditions

Conditions like chronic back pain, os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, and fibromyalgia, which can affect an athlete’s performance, are managed using evidence-based physiotherapy interventions.

Balance and Coordination Disorders

Athletes with balance problems or coordination issues due to neurological conditions or injuries can benefit from our tailored sports rehabilitation programs.

An Overview of techniques used in Sports Physiotherapy at Momentum

Manual Therapy:

Our physiotherapists are skilled in hands-on techniques like joint mobilizations, manipulations, and soft tissue massage to alleviate pain, improve mobility, and enhance performance.

Exercise Prescription

We develop individualized exercise programs to improve strength, flexibility, balance, and endurance, focusing on the specific requirements of your sport.

Dry Needling

This technique uses thin needles to relieve muscle tension, reduce pain, and promote healing, particularly useful for sports-related muscle and joint pain.

Sports Taping and Bracing

To protect injured muscles and joints and provide support during the healing process, we offer sports taping and bracing.

Biomechanical Assessments

We analyze your movement patterns and body alignment to identify abnormalities, understand the cause of your injury, and guide our treatment approach.

Education and Training

Beyond physical treatment, we educate athletes on injury prevention, proper sports techniques, and self-care strategies.
